What does a transportation associate do?

A Transportation Associate is responsible for supporting the logistics and transportation operations of a company. Their duties often include coordinating shipments, tracking deliveries, ensuring proper documentation, and sometimes assisting with loading and unloading goods. They work closely with drivers, warehouse staff, and logistics managers to ensure that items are delivered safely, on time, and in compliance with company and regulatory standards. This role requires good organizational skills, attention to detail, and effective communication to help keep transportation processes running smoothly.

What are some common challenges faced by transportation associates, and how can they be effectively managed?

Transportation Associates often encounter challenges such as tight delivery schedules, adapting to changes in routes or logistics, and coordinating with multiple team members across departments. Effectively managing these challenges involves staying organized, maintaining clear communication with dispatchers and drivers, and being flexible with sudden changes. Proactively addressing issues, such as delays or equipment malfunctions, and leveraging technology to track shipments can help ensure tasks are completed efficiently and safely.

Job Summary

Responsible for facilitating the safe and efficient transportation of patients, medical equipment, and supplies within the healthcare facility. Responsible for coordinating transportation logistics, ensuring timely and accurate delivery, and maintaining a high level of professionalism and customer service.

Essential Functions

  • Safely transport patients within the healthcare facility, including from their rooms to various departments, such as radiology, surgery, and physical therapy.
  • Assist patients with boarding and disembarking from transportation vehicles, ensuring their comfort and well-being.
  • Transport medical equipment, supplies, and specimens between departments and storage areas.
  • Ensure proper handling and care of delicate and sensitive equipment.
  • Adhere to infection control and safety protocols while handling and transporting materials.
  • Coordinate transportation requests and schedules to ensure prompt and efficient service.
  • Collaborate with nurses, physicians, and other healthcare professionals to prioritize transportation needs and accommodate urgent requests.
